1. Wire brush along the washers until they are cut apart, right over the O-rings if already installed.
2. Heat the Leather over the range on low heat or on the dash of your truck until it is hot to the touch.
3. Apply Sno-Seal and allow it to melt and absorb into the leather.
4. Repeat...
5. Repeat some more...
6. Wipe w/ a rag or paper towel to remove excess wax when finished.
The Leather will have a spun fiber feel as well as being water and chem-proof.
Added to the O-rings on the U/F handles... they are non-slip.

What surprised me was how tough those O-rings are.
That's a coarse stainless-steel wire brush, like ya use to clean a BBQ or de-slag a weld...
...Didn't even phase the O-rings. Neither did the open flame heating and hot Sno-Seal.
